5.13 Overspeed Alert:
This function is using for the owner to control the targets speed.
5.13.1 Set up: Send SMS speed+password+space+080 to the unit (suppose the speed
is 80km/h), and it will reply speed ok!. When the target moves exceeding 80 km/h, the
unit will send SMS speed+080!+Geo-info to the authorized numbers.
It
will
keep
sending
such
an
alert
every
3
minutes.
5.13.2 Cancel: Send SMS nospeed+password to deactivate the overspeed alert
Remark: It is recommended that the speed alarm is set at not less than 50km/h. For
below that rate, it may cause the excursion of the GPS signal influenced by clounds etc.
Response SMS format: speed+080!+Geo-info (suppose the speed is 80km/h).
The tracker will check the speed in 10 minutes interval and alarm if it is overspeed.
5.14 IMEI Checking:
Send SMS imei+password to the unit to check the IMEI number of the tracker.
5.15 SOS Button
Press the SOS for 3 second, it will send help me !+ Geo-info to all the authorized
numbers every 3 minutes. It will stop sending such a SMS when any authorized number
reply SMS help me! to the tracker.
5.16 Low Battery Alert
It begins to send SMS to the user every 30minutes when the the battery voltage is 3.7V.
SMS format: low battery+Geo-info.
